My first trip following my return to railfanning in 1998 was to Essex, MT. I walked along US Highway 2 from the Izaak Walton Inn to Java East, just after sunrise. Found a rail gang there, pulling old worn-out section and laying new ribbonrail. After a few hours, an eastbound empty grain train came rolling up the hill, complete with a pair of brand spanking new C44s and pristine covered grain hoppers.
For someone who had last railfanned in the early 1980s, everything that day was new.
